【文件属性】:
文件名称:fsharp-hedgehog-experimental:附带电池的刺猬
文件大小:123KB
文件格式:ZIP
更新时间:2021-05-23 10:27:56
testing property-based-testing hedgehog combinators F#
fsharp-hedgehog-实验
带有电池的包括:自动发电机,额外的组合器等。
特征
自动生成任意类型
功能的产生
很多方便的组合器
例子
便利组合器
无需显式使用Range即可生成列表:
let! exponentialList = Gen.bool |> GenX.eList 1 5 // Same as Gen.list (Range.exponential 1 5)
let! linearList = Gen.bool |> GenX.lList 1 5 // Same as Gen.list (Range.linear 1 5)
let! constantList = Gen.bool |> GenX.cList 1 5 // Same as Gen.list (Range.constant 1 5)
无需显式使用Range即可生成字符串:
let
【文件预览】:
fsharp-hedgehog-experimental-master
----.gitignore(610B)
----src()
--------Hedgehog.Experimental.Tests()
--------Hedgehog.Experimental.sln(2KB)
--------Hedgehog.Experimental()
----LICENSE(596B)
----CHANGELOG.md(1KB)
----.github()
--------workflows()
----README.md(8KB)
----img()
--------SQUARE_hedgehog_615x615.png(27KB)
--------hedgehog.png(59KB)
--------SQUARE_hedgehog_300x300.png(27KB)
----.editorconfig(114B)